    77/17 years of production?

    The 77/17mach2 rifles were manufactured in 2004 -2005. I believe the 17 HMR's came out shortly before them.. Ruger web site/product history serial number section states the 77/17 was introduced in 2002.

    35 Rimington - First time

    The spirals in the Remington 141's tubular magazine were designed to offset the cartridge just enough to prevent a bullet tip from contacting the primer of the cartridge in front of it.

    Ruger Letters Came today

    In 2008 I received a letter from Ruger regarding a No.1 that stated, "Our records show that this rifle was manufactured in November of 2003 and shipped in December of 2006, as a model K1-H-BBZ, .416 Rigby caliber.".
